I contacted 'Ella' to have my son go in to get the legs hemmed on his tuxedo. I asked the appropriate questions regarding her services and the expected time for her to perform such a small task. She was pleasant enough and informed me that she charges $13.50 for the service. As she does drop in, there was no need to set up an appointment, we informed her that he would make sure it was not during her lunch which is from 1-2:30pm. I contacted my son, who is 16 and let him know when and were to be. 

My son went to pick up the tuxedo with his friend who also had the same alteration done and the expectation of paying the $13.50 for the service requested. Instead, we received a call from our son that 'Ella' demanded $85. He didn't know what to do, didn't know what to say to her other than he would be back. I contacted her via phone to find out what was going on. I did not get the same pleasant 'Ella' that I had before. I was calm and asked what happened between our last conversation when she informed me that the hemming of his pants would be $13.50 and her stand off for $85.00. She told me that he 'had the jacket done too....and he had another boy with him that had the same thing done. She said, 'you didn't want him walking out of here looking like he was drug in from the streets, did you?' I told her he was 16 years old, he came in for a hem. How did this happen?? She immediately snapped back with a snide comment about 'how about taking responsibility for this, he is your son, his communication with you is not my responsibility.' After I asked her about being a responsible business owner who provides a service, she told me 'With the level of my business, MY REPUTATION CAN TAKE THE HIT. BESIDES, THEY GO TO PRIVATE SCHOOL.'  I asked her what that meant, she replied, 'I assumed they could afford it.' 

I was nearly speechless. These two boys who went in to have the pant legs hemmed clearly were taken for a ride by this shyster who merely sized the inexperienced boys up for whatever she could get out of them. I informed her that they were paying for the alterations, and they didn't have $85. Was she really going to hold their suits hostage for thes trumped up work? She then had the nerve to tell me that in '20 years, you are the first person to ever pull this on me.' Not really sure what I was supposedly pulling on her. She said she isn't responsible to verify work. He's a child, I told her. 'I don't know how old he is!' she yelled back. But, she knew he attended high school. 

I told her I would call her back and pay for my sons alterations so he could attend his formal. I called my son, the other boy was nearly in tears because they thought the charge was $13.50. He didn't have the money and there was no way to get it. I called 'Ella' back. I figured I could reason with her on behalf of the other boy in a calm manner. When she answered the phone, I introduced myself as the mother, and said. 'ma'am, please understand that just because someone attends private school, doesn't mean they have money. Many of the children who go to private school have scholarships. These boys work to help pay for their education.'

She hung up on me. Not a joke. She hung up the phone. She knew I was calling her to give her payment, and she HUNG UP THE PHONE.

Being over 5 hours away, I had no other alternative. I called the Police Department and explained the situation. Whatever the outcome, no matter what I am willing to pay for my son to retrieve his property being held hostage by this woman, it will require the intervention of a police officer. 

Whatever you do, please stay away from this woman and her 'business' if there is an alternative.

I called her for a prom alteration and even from the second she answered the phone, I could tell there was something off about this woman. However, I didn't feel like trying to find another person to do my alterations. I took my dress in and she informed me that she couldn't make it smaller because of the fabric, but it needed to be hemmed. So I said okay and asked her when it would be done. She said Friday (the day before prom) or first thing on the day of. So I left my dress there and hoped for the best. Saturday at 11:30 came along, and I began to panic because I need a dress. I called three times with no answer, and decided to just show up and hope that someone was there. I arrived and sure enough she was there, watching TV. I said that I called and was wondering when my dress was done. "It's already done" she said. Was she planning on telling me that? So I asked her what the price was, planning on $20 or so. She charged me $60. When I got into my car, I studied the dress. Since it was a mesh hem, all she had to do was cut it. There was no sewing or anything needed, and it probably took her 5 minutes. (I could have done that myself). The more I think about that whole situation, the angrier I get.
